Output 431431bfce20ead49b3a322f9c8e3efa754a8e21a2074bbdee1bd2478e39ea7a:0

value
18362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 029cd3027147c3653bd73af4c0ecfece01e2954e OP_EQUAL
address
31vq9GUxchxUAmZBkkgHy4s94AQcDS9pKQ
transaction
431431bfce20ead49b3a322f9c8e3efa754a8e21a2074bbdee1bd2478e39ea7a
spent
true